Kentucky's housing stock includes a variety of home styles, from older farmhouses to newer suburban residences. The type of chimney, whether it serves a wood-burning fireplace, gas logs, or a furnace, influences the cleaning approach. Wood-burning chimneys are particularly prone to creosote buildup, a flammable substance that requires professional removal.

The state's climate, with its cold winters and humid summers, can impact chimney performance. Regular cleaning and inspection help identify potential issues like creosote accumulation or blockages. How often does a chimney really need to be cleaned?

In Kentucky, with its cold winters, annual chimney cleaning is recommended if you use your fireplace or heating appliance regularly. For less frequent use, an inspection every two years is advisable. Consistent use of your heating appliance mandates more frequent service.

What are the signs of a dirty chimney?

Signs of a dirty chimney include visible soot or creosote buildup, a smoky smell when the appliance is not in use, or difficulty starting and maintaining a fire. You might also notice black streaks on the exterior of your chimney or a decrease in your home's heating efficiency. These are indicators for professional cleaning.
